I was recently browsing the interwebs for info, and came across this link for Beretta Customer Support: http://w ww.berettasupport.com/applications/tech_data/schematics_search_new.htm.

It allows you to look up your serial number, and it will display its info, along with links for your user's manual, parts/schematics (via Brownells), and brochure.

I plugged in a serial # from a 96D I picked up from a sponsor a few years ago as a police trade-in, and it shows some cool info!

Serial Number: ######XX
Model: SPEC0081A
Product Description: M96 SPECIAL- VANCOUVER PD
Approximate Manufacture Date: 1996
Parts Listing: Parts
Owners Manual: Manual
Product Brochure or Literature: Brochure
